Senior State Department Official Resigns Over Trump’s Response To Racial Injustice
Mary Elizabeth Taylor, one of the highest-ranking Black officials in the administration, said Trump’s actions “cut sharply against my core values.”



Mary Elizabeth Taylor, one of the highest-ranking African American officials in the Trump administration, resigned on Thursday over President Donald Trump’s response to racial tensions across the nation, The Washington Post reported.
Taylor, 30, was the youngest person and first Black woman to serve as assistant secretary of state for legislative affairs in the State Department.

In her resignation letter to Secretary of State Mike Pompeo, obtained by the Post, Taylor said the president’s “comments and actions surrounding racial injustice and Black Americans” had “cut sharply against my core values and convictions.”


“Moments of upheaval can change you, shift the trajectory of your life, and mold your character,” wrote Taylor, who has served with the Trump administration since its first day in January 2017. “I must follow the dictates of my conscience and resign as Assistant Secretary of State for Legislative Affairs.”
Mary Elizabeth Taylor, in the admin since Jan ‘17, writes: “The President’s comments and actions surrounding racial injustice and Black Americans cut sharply against my core values and convictions. I must follow the dictates of my conscience and resign” https://t.co/DpTJJXy4wZ
— Seung Min Kim (@seungminkim) June 18, 2020
Trump has come under scrutiny for his response to anti-racism protests across the country since the police killing last month of George Floyd, a Black Minneapolis man.

As protesters took to the streets in Minneapolis, Trump called demonstrators “thugs” and tweeted that “when the looting starts, the shooting starts.”
He was later skewered for ordering police to clear protesters with tear gas and rubber bullets so he could walk to the front of a Washington, D.C., church for a photo-op; and on Wednesday, he told The Wall Street Journal that he’d made Juneteenth, the day celebrating the end of slavery in America, “very famous” after his controversial decision to hold a campaign rally that day in Tulsa, Oklahoma ― where a racist massacre took place in 1921. Trump has since postponed the rally by one day.

Pennsylvania police officer fired for 'racist and derogatory' email about Black people, journalists and politicians


A longtime Pennsylvania police officer was fired Thursday after sending a "racist and derogatory" email to the mayor and local news reporters.

Erie Mayor Joe Schember announced the firing of 62-year-old Sgt. Jeff Annunziata at a press conference, alongside Police Chief Dan Spizarny. In his email, Annunziata said Black people seeking social justice “cannot take care of their own or anyone else without playing the race card.” He also defended his profession and criticized journalists.

“Sgt. Jeff Annunziata sent an email to members of the media containing racist and derogatory statements,” Schember said. “I condemn these statements. I am appalled and disgusted by the racial insensitivity of this email.”

The Erie Times-News of the USA TODAY Network first reported the contents of Annunziata's email about six hours before Schember’s announcement.

a0fc968c-6cdb-4dad-b51a-0a093c1460ad-USP_News__Erie_PA_Police_Officer_Firing.jpg



Spizarny said he immediately suspended Annunziata after an internal affairs investigation found he had sent the email from his city account and identified himself as a police officer.

“I speak for the command staff when I say that we are all sickened by the language of Mr. Annunziata,” Spizarny said.

The city’s solicitor, Ed Betza, said Annunziata was not working when he sent the email, adding the union representing city police, Erie Fraternal Order of Police Lodge No. 7, has 10 days to challenge Annunziata’s termination.

“It’s their legal right to do so,” Betza said.

Annunziata, the chief traffic investigator for Erie police and a 34-year veteran of the police bureau, earned an annual base pay of $103,631, according to city records.

He sent his email shortly before 7 p.m. Monday, the same day Schember had announced that another Erie police officer who kicked a seated protester would receive three days unpaid suspension and be required to undergo sensitivity training.

In his email, Annunziata also claimed that citizens “do not understand compliance;” asserted that most police officers try to avoid confrontation; suggested without evidence that the Clinton Foundation and billionaire George Soros are funding Black Lives Matter and antifa; and mentioned that Erie officer Richard Burchick was shot and killed in 1991 by a Black man.
